The precision of yacht flooring
In yacht building, tolerances are exceptionally small. Every surface must align seamlessly with curved lines, compact spaces, and detailed structures - leaving no room for error. The level of precision required is unlike any other environment, demanding both technical expertise and material excellence.
This is why yacht flooring calls for true specialists. From land to sea: Design freedom into yacht interiors
Beyond technical precision, yacht interiors are about design freedom. Just like a residence on land, a yacht interior can reflect a client’s personality, lifestyle, and vision. The difference is that on the water, space is more limited - which makes every choice count even more. For designers, this turns a yacht into a fascinating challenge: compact yet expressive, functional yet refined.
Flooring is often where that vision begins. It is the surface people see and touch every day, the foundation that sets the atmosphere for the entire space. A light herringbone pattern can make a cabin feel open and timeless, while darker wide planks bring warmth and intimacy. Subtle variations in tone, texture, and pattern give architects and designers powerful tools to shape the onboard experience.
